Macon-Bibb Celebrates the Start of Construction on the New Macon Arena
Wednesday, July 29th, 2026
Macon-Bibb County will officially break ground on the new Macon Arena on Wednesday, July 29, at 9:00 a.m. at 200 Coliseum Drive, marking the start of construction of one of the community's most significant investments in sports, entertainment, and economic development.
Community leaders, project partners, and guests will gather to celebrate the beginning of construction on the state-of-the-art facility, which will replace the nearly 60-year-old Macon Coliseum. The new Macon Arena will help position Macon-Bibb County as a premier destination for concerts, sporting events, conventions, family entertainment, and community gatherings. The existing Coliseum will remain operational during construction.
"This groundbreaking represents far more than the start of construction; it’s a celebration of our investment in our people, our economy, and our future," says Mayor Lester Miller. "We're building a place where future generations will make memories, where our community can gather to celebrate, compete, and connect, and where visitors from across the region and country will experience everything Macon has to offer."
The project is led by MFA Project Management, with PBK Architects serving as the design firm and Barton Malow + Sheridan Construction overseeing construction. The designs were unveiled at a Big Reveal on June 24, and you can see more from that milestone here.
